Disable LALT-ESC
It would be nice to be able to disable the LALT-ESC key combination from minimizing the Amiga display. I use that combination as a hot key on the Amiga. I'll admit that LALT-ESC works a lot better then LALT-TAB but I don't switch very often between Windows and the Amiga, so that combination as a hot key for the Amiga is much more useful then for minimizing the screen.
If there is already a way to do it I haven't found it yet, and I've tried. If there is please advice. |

Windows built-in shortcuts usually can't be disabled, at least without using some hacks which can break in future Windows updates or versions.
Rawinput RIDEV_NOHOTKEYS should disable hotkeys but for some reason it only disables some hotkeys which is confusing.. |

Maybe I'm not understanding something here. Using LALT-ESC on the Amiga side has never been a problem until after WinUAE 2100, this is the highest version I can use because when I hit that key combination on higher versions the WinUAE display suddenly minimizes. When I maximize the display the operation that LALT-ESC was supposed to do on the Amiga side has been done. It looks like higher versions of WinUAE then 2100 are detecting LALT-ESC, minimizing the display, and then passing the keys on to the Amiga. I'm talking LALT-ESC, NOT LALT-TAB. I actually went back and tried the older versions and the problem started with the release after 2100. I'm running XP and nothing changed during the testing. |

It is DirectInput to RawInput switch that makes the difference.
RawInput is much better except it has this slightly leaky NOHOTKEYS filter. |
